Zeynep Cetecioglu Gurol is an Associate Professor at the Royal Institute of Technology (KTH) specializing in Environmental Biotechnology. Her research focuses on the development of innovative biotechnological solutions for wastewater treatment systems that combine energy recovery with sustainable practices. She leads a research group with three main lines of inquiry: the recovery of value-added products from waste streams, the development of synthetic microbial communities for mixed-culture feedstock production, and strategies for phosphorus recovery from anoxic sediments. Dr. Gurol has a PhD from Istanbul Technical University where her thesis assessed the biodegradability of antibiotics in mixed microbial cultures. She is actively involved in multidisciplinary projects aimed at enhancing the valorization of marine and food waste resources, fostering environmentally sustainable materials development, and improving societal impacts of biotechnological innovations.
